ThinkPHP的模板中如何将模板变量传入模板中的JS中
1、在逻辑中映射值到模板中:$this-assign(aa,$aa); 模板中直接在js中这样用就可以:alert({$aa}); 你随便传一个值试试,看看能不鞥alert出来。
2、在后台代码中将数组assign出去,然后在模板的js代码中就可以通过{$array}调用啦。
3、首先分配 变量到模板 $this-assign(变量名,变量);然后模板中调用就可以了,不分什么JS,还是HTML。
tp5怎么引入css,js文件
1、首先,静态资源应该放在public中。一般与public放同级目录的文件,都是不希望被外部访问到的私有文件。可以在服务端中访问到。css,js属于公开文件,在模板中加载的话。只能从根目录开始找。
2、首先说模板要放在与模板对应的文件夹中,然后css和js等外部引用的文件要在你模板目录下新建一个名叫public的文件夹,css和js文件就是放在这个文件夹中的。
3、html5使用link标签引入外围的css样式表。
4、链接外部的js文件和css文件需要使用标签和ink标签。标签 定义和用法 标签用于定义客户端脚本,比如 JavaScript。script 元素既可以包含脚本语句,也可以通过 src 属性指向外部脚本文件。
5、DOCTYPEhtml,以使浏览器能认识到我们的文档是一个html5的文件,这样就可以快速的正确解读,以提高浏览的体验。我们写一个title的标签,将网页的题目写入进去,让网页的标题显示为“引入外部css文件和外部js文件”。
6、既然是引用js文件,你怎么用link?应该用script。就行你引用jQuery一样啊。啊,看错了。
如何在js模块中调用thinkPHP的变量
在逻辑中映射值到模板中:$this-assign(aa,$aa); 模板中直接在js中这样用就可以:alert({$aa}); 你随便传一个值试试,看看能不鞥alert出来。
首先分配 变量到模板 $this-assign(变量名,变量);然后模板中调用就可以了,不分什么JS,还是HTML。
在调用这个js文件的模板文件中,在调用js之前,加上这句: var publicurl=__PUBLIC__; ;然后在js文件中使用publicurl这个变量就行了。
在后台代码中将数组assign出去,然后在模板的js代码中就可以通过{$array}调用啦。
div id=div1 onclick=dianji(?php echo $k1 ?) ?php echo $k1 ? //把k1传递给js代码,这里开始出问题。
thinkphp如何向模板中的js传变量
1、在逻辑中映射值到模板中:$this-assign(aa,$aa); 模板中直接在js中这样用就可以:alert({$aa}); 你随便传一个值试试,看看能不鞥alert出来。
2、首先分配 变量到模板 $this-assign(变量名,变量);然后模板中调用就可以了,不分什么JS,还是HTML。
3、在后台代码中将数组assign出去,然后在模板的js代码中就可以通过{$array}调用啦。
关于thinkphp调用模板js方法和thinkphp教程的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。